Othello, Desdemona, Iago: passion, love, hate.
A show that moves from one room to the next as the various scenes
are performed in different settings of one of the most fascinating Venetian Palaces.
The public is greeted from the windows of the gallery, to then proceed to Pietro Longhi’s staircase; the courtyard and the final scene in the magnificent‘Sala della Musica’.
Ca’ Sagredo, the wonderful Venetian Palace on the Grand Canal, takes its name from the last noble Venetian family who has owned and loved it.
The façade onto the Grand Canal is proof of the Byzantine origin of the building, which was altered several times in subsequent centuries
